The Rise of Organic Farming
Organic farming, a method of crop and livestock production that involves much more than choosing not to use pesticides, genetically modified organisms, antibiotics, and growth hormones, is witnessing a global upsurge. It encompasses a holistic system designed to optimize the productivity and fitness of diverse communities within the agro-ecosystem, including soil organisms, plants, livestock, and people.

Expansion of Organic Farming Practices
Organic Crop Cultivation
Soil Management and Nutrient Optimization
In organic farming, the soil is seen as a living entity. Thus, soil management and nutrient optimization play a crucial role in organic crop cultivation. Techniques such as composting, green manure, and crop rotation are used to improve soil fertility.
Crop Rotation and Cover Crops
Crop rotation and cover crops are integral to organic farming. These practices help improve soil structure, enhance nutrient cycling, and manage pests and diseases.
Pest and Weed Management in Organic Farming
Organic farming takes a preventative approach to pest and weed management. Through techniques like biological control, habitat manipulation, and modified cultural practices, pests and weeds are kept under control without the use of synthetic pesticides.
Organic Livestock Farming
Ethical Animal Welfare Practices
Animal welfare is a cornerstone of organic livestock farming. Practices like free-range housing, lower stocking densities, and avoidance of routine mutilations are some examples of ethical treatment in organic farming.
Organic Feed and Grazing Methods
Organic livestock are primarily fed organic feed and allowed to graze in open pastures, ensuring the animals are healthy and the meat produced is of high quality.
Disease Prevention and Treatment in Organic Livestock
Organic farming emphasizes disease prevention over treatment. This involves breeding for resistance, maintaining a healthy living environment, and ensuring appropriate nutrition and stress management.
Climate Change and Organic Farming
Mitigating Climate Change Impact through Organic Practices
Organic farming practices can mitigate climate change impacts. By enhancing soil organic matter and promoting biodiversity, organic farming can increase the resilience of agricultural systems to climate change.
Drought and Flood Resistant Organic Crops
The selection and breeding of drought and flood-resistant organic crops can enhance resilience to climate change, ensuring food security under unpredictable weather conditions.
Carbon Sequestration in Organic Soils
Organic soils, rich in organic matter, play a significant role in carbon sequestration. By storing carbon, these soils can help mitigate greenhouse gas emissions, contributing to climate change mitigation.

FAQs Related to The Future of Organic Farming
Q1.What is organic farming?
The future of organic farming is bright and organic farming is a method of agriculture that excludes the use of synthetic inputs like pesticides, fertilizers, genetically modified organisms, and emphasizes sustainability, biodiversity, and environmentally-friendly practices.
Q2. How does organic farming benefit the environment?
Organic farming benefits the environment by reducing soil degradation and pollution, enhancing biodiversity, promoting a healthier ecosystem, and contributing to carbon sequestration, which mitigates climate change.
Q3. Why are organic products generally more expensive?
Organic products are generally more expensive due to higher production costs, stringent certification processes, and the extensive labor involved in organic farming practices.
Q4. What does organic certification entail?
Organic certification involves verifying that a farm or handling facility complies with organic regulations, ensuring that both production and processing methods meet specific standards.
Q5. What is the impact of technology on organic farming?
Technology impacts organic farming by improving efficiency, precision, and productivity, offering tools for better crop management, soil analysis, and data-driven decision making.
